Least Common Multiple of 58037 and 58043 with GCF Formula

The formula of LCM is LCM(a,b) = ( a × b) / GCF(a,b).
We need to calculate greatest common factor 58037 and 58043, than apply into the LCM equation.

GCF(58037,58043) = 1
LCM(58037,58043) = ( 58037 × 58043) / 1
LCM(58037,58043) = 3368641591 / 1
LCM(58037,58043) = 3368641591
